The Gauteng Department of e-Government will introduce 30 additional free Wi-Fi hotspot sites in the province on Thursday, December 5, 2024, as part of its ongoing Wi-Fi project launched in 2014. By the end of the financial year 2024/25, a total of 353 sites will be provided with WAN, and 250 will become Wi-Fi hotspots. A media tour is scheduled in Deveyton to unveil these new sites.
The Gauteng Department of e-Government has announced that it will launch 30 more free Wi-Fi hotspot sites in the province on Thursday, 5 December 2024., the e-Government department noted that its Wi-Fi project launched in 2014 and has connected more than 1,200 sites across the province.
The department is hosting a media tour in Deveyton on Thursday, 5 December, to unveil and activate 30 new sites in the province as part of its mandate to provide Internet connectivity across Gauteng.
